== Franchise Agreement: Millbrook Grove ==

''Restricted: branch managers only.''

The franchise agreement with Torville Retail Partners was renewed this quarter. Standard terms apply: five-year term, fixed royalty, shared marketing fund. Branch managers should route all franchisee queries through the partnerships desk, not directly. One confidential point on forward plans appears below.

confidential, taweg-faduf: The board signed off on a budget of $288.7 million for Project Casax.

## Environments — Hawkmere Admin Dashboard (Dark Mode)

Dark-mode theming is served per environment: staging uses the experimental palette, production the approved one. Theme tokens load from the environment config at startup, not at build time, so maintainers should never hardcode colors. The production environment currently loads the following values.

service settings:
PRAIX_LOG_LEVEL=error
PRAIX_METRICS_HOST=metrics.praix.qorvelcorp.corp
PRAIX_POOL_SIZE=16

/*
 * FEED_POLL_INTERVAL_MS controls how often plugins may query the
 * Stackerly garage occupancy feed. Do not go lower: the upstream
 * counters at the Delmont Ramp aggregate on a 15-second window, so
 * faster polling returns stale duplicates and burns your quota.
 * Values are cached per-level; floors report independently. If your
 * plugin sees impossible counts (negative or > capacity), capture
 * the response and file it against the feed build noted below.
 */

pipeline stamp: htk9_6ce9d33c5

Q: Why do I only see some of the logs from Pondersync? A: Because it's incredibly chatty, we sample aggressively — roughly 1 in 50 info lines make it to storage, while errors and warnings always ship in full. If you're debugging and need everything, you can bump the sample rate per-service for up to two hours. Just remember to flip it back, or the ingest bill gets ugly. The toggle and current sampling config live on the page below.

operations page: https://jenkins.zemvarcloud.local/job/merge_requests/repo/build/73930b4b30f0a8ed